Description
A group of three chest tombs from the 19th century is located about 3 metres west of the nave of the Church of St Michael in Caerhays. Each tomb is made of granite and features a rectangular shape with a high chamfered plinth and a flat top that has a moulded edge. All three tombs have illegible inscriptions carved on their tops.
